Se você tem um projeto digital a desenvolver, há boas chances de ser apresentado ao framework Django.
Afinal, ele é um dos mais utilizados atualmente.
Neste conteúdo, você vai entender por que isso acontece.
Também vai conferir detalhes sobre as suas aplicações, vantagens no uso e todas as informações que precisa para participar ativamente do processo.
Acompanhe nossas dicas!
O que é o Django framework?
Django é um framework de código aberto que usa a linguagem de programação Python.
No entanto, essa explicação pouco será útil se você não souber o que significa framework, certo?
Então, vamos lá: framework é uma ferramenta que conta com diversos componentes que ajudam na construção de soluções digitais.
Basicamente, ela simplifica o trabalho de programadores e desenvolvedores, facilitando tarefas mecânicas e repetitivas.
Existem diversos tipos de frameworks, mas o Django é específico para a linguagem Python e um dos mais utilizados para programações com esse modelo de código.
6 aplicações do Django em seus projetos
Agora que você sabe o que é o Django, conheça seis diferentes aplicações que o framework oferece aos seus projetos:
- Formulários HTML: o Django facilita a criação, o processamento e a validação de formulários, usados para reunir informações do usuário para o servidor
- Permissões e autenticações de usuários: conta com um sistema que foca na segurança na hora de autenticar e dar permissões ao usuário
- Sistema de cache: dispõe de um sistema de armazenamento em cache flexível, que faz com que o conteúdo seja mais leve e rápido – tudo para que uma página pronta não precise ser inteiramente renderizada novamente
- Padronização no site de administração: o framework Django possibilita que qualquer app seja feito a partir de uma estrutura básica, isto é, os modelos de dados podem ser criados, modificados e mostrados com muito mais facilidade
- Dados serializados: ao oferecer esse recurso, o Django permite que aplicativos web, por exemplo, sejam desenvolvidos de modo mais simples
- URLs amigáveis: por fim, o Django facilita a boa indexação das páginas do seu app web pelo Google, pois conta com parâmetro de códigos que deixa as URLs amigáveis.
7 vantagens do framework Django
Se você ainda tem alguma dúvida de que o Django pode ser o framework ideal para o desenvolvimento do seu projeto, confira estas sete vantagens:
- É conceituado, sendo um dos frameworks mais utilizados do mercado
- É extremamente completo, com o seu pacote de plugins, então, você pode criar soluções fora da caixa
- É versátil, pois apesar de usar linguagem Python, entrega conteúdos nos mais variados formatos, como HTML, XML, RSS
- É seguro, ativando proteção contra vulnerabilidades e acionando dispositivos automáticos de segurança, como no gerenciamento de senhas, por exemplo
- É multiplataforma, pois pode ser escrito em Mac OS X, Linux e Windows
- É reutilizável, baseando-se no princípio “Don’t Repeat Yourself” (DRY)
- É escalável, pois cada arquitetura independe da outra.
Quer saber mais sobre a linguagem Python, o framework Django e colocar em prática o seu projeto digital?
Entre em contato com o Mundo DevOps, pois teremos o maior prazer em firmar essa parceria com você!